Lynn not just about herself

2 min read

Name: Lacey Lynn

School: Central

Age: 17

Grade: Senior

Sport: Softball

Athlete of the week achievement: Lynn homered twice and doubled, drove in six runs and scored three times in an 11-1 win over Bishop McCort in the first game of a doubleheader. She had two hits, scored a run and was the winning pitcher while striking out 15 in the second game, an 8-5 victory. Earlier in the week, Lynn was the winning pitcher, struck out eight, had two hits, scored twice and had an RBI in an 11-1 win over Richland.

Season update: Lynn is hitting .556 with 12 RBIs, two doubles and three home runs. She's also scored nine runs for the 5-0 Lady Dragons.

Coach Jonathan Burket's quote: "She's one of the most amazing young ladies you could ever meet. Not only does she do work for herself, but she helps with the younger girls and tries to help improve their game too."
